Riteish Deshmukh turns director; Genelia Deshmukh to make her Marathi film debut December 08, 2021 at 04:31PM

 Riteish Deshmukh made his acting debut with the Hindi film Tujhe Meri Kasam in 2003. He was cast opposite Genelia D'Souza in the film. Now, almost twenty years later, Riteish will be taking charge from behind the camera as he turns director with the Marathi film Ved which means madness.

Riteish Deshmukh turns director; Genelia Deshmukh to make her Marathi film debut

On Wednesday, Riteish took to his Twitter handle to share the poster of the film which will also star his wife and actress Genelia Deshmukh. The film will mark Genelia's return to the screen after a long break. "After being in front of the camera for 20 years, I take a big leap to stand behind it for the first time. As I direct my first Marathi film, I humbly ask you all for your good wishes and blessings. Be a part of this journey, be a part of this madness.  वेड (Madness)," Riteish wrote while sharing the poster of the film.


Presented by Mumbai Film Company, it is an Ajay-Atul musical. The film also stars Jiya Shankar apart from Riteish and Genelia Deshmukh. Genelia who has delivered hits in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, Kannada, and Malayalam languages will be making her Marathi language debut with Ved.

Tandav controversy: Supreme Court refuses to grant protection from arrest to makers; says freedom of speech is not absolute January 27, 2021 at 04:37PM

On Wednesday while hearing pleas seeking stay on FIRs against actors and producers of the web series Tandav , the Supreme Court said that freedom of speech is not absolute. A bench headed by Ashok Bhushan said that the petitioners should go to the high courts to seek quashing of these cases. The court also refused to grant protection from arrest to the makers of Tandav against whom FIRs have been filed. The case was heard by a bench of justices Ashok Bhushan, RS Reddy and MR Shah. Senior advocates Fali S Nariman, Mukul Rohatgi and Siddharth Luthra cited the recent judgement of the top court in Arnab Goswami's case during the hearing. "Is this way liberty should be protected in the country and FIRs are being filed across the country," Luthra said adding that the director of the web series, Ali Abbas Zafar, is being harassed. Paresh Rawal replaces Rishi Kapoor and resumes shoot for Sharmaji Namkeen June 30, 2021 at 04:06PM

As the Maharashtra government announced some ease in lockdown restrictions, many films have resumed their shoots. Late actor Rishi Kapoor's last film Sharmaji Namkeen has also gone on floors. Rishi played the central character in the movie and passed away on April 30, last year. His remaining portions of the film were taken over by veteran actor Paresh Rawal. Paresh Rawal started shooting for the remaining portions in March this year. However, with the second wave of the novel coronavirus, the shoot came to a halt again. According to a daily, Paresh Rawal has resumed the shoot for an important sequence at a school in Goregaon, Mumbai which also features Juhi Chawla and Satish Kaushik. The team along with Paresh Rawal will shoot for a week-long schedule, after which the movie will wrap up and go for the post-production process.
